Montchavin


At the beginning...
The ski resorts were established between the two world wars. This period, the "big bang" of the winter sports, ended with the creation of a renowned resort in Haute Savoie just after 1945. This resort was an achievment of the baroness of Rotschild to challenge the neighbouring Swiss alpine resorts.


At the beginning, most resorts were called “inserted”, (i.e. buildings in harmony with landscapes). However, the architecture does not always respect the traditional style of the mountain in the region.

Between the 70’s and the 80’s, a new generation of resorts was established with constructions style, which respects the architectural style of the Alpine Valley (woods, stones and louses). Montchavin is part of this new generation.

At first, Montchavin was a little village basically living from farming and agriculture. At the beginning of the 70’s, there were only 12 inhabitants in the village. Indeed, young inhabitants flew the valley because of the drop of agricultural and industrial activities in Tarentaise.

To remedy this rural exodus, Auguste Mudry, the commune’s mayor, decided on a renovation and development plan for the village. He asked the SAP (The company in charge of the development of La Plagne resort) to invest in Montchavin. This request was accepted on condition to create at least five hundred tourist beds for the installation of the first ski lift and 1500 tourist beds for a link with La Plagne.

The architect Michel Bezançon was in charge of the renovation of the village. The new buildings were built near the village centre (next to the slopes), the centre of the village is renovated and all shops established.

The bed capacity reached 1500 in Montchavin in 1973. The SAP built the chair lift “Arpette” and the “Dos Rond” and “Salla” chair lifts were built too. There is also a link with the La Plagne ski area.
